Miles College vs. UAM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Miles College or UAM?

  • Miles College is 119.3% more expensive to attend than UAM for in-state tuition ($11,164.00 vs. $5,091.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 2% higher at Miles College than University of Arkansas at Monticello ($11,164.00 vs. $10,941.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Arkansas at Monticello than Miles College ($12,693 vs. $13,283)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Arkansas at Monticello are 0.4% lower than costs at Miles College ($7,320 vs. $7,348)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Arkansas at Monticello than Miles College (100% vs. 95%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Miles College students is 1.1% larger than aid received University of Arkansas at Monticello ($9,391 vs. $9,286)

Miles College vs. UAM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Miles College or UAM?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between UAM and Miles College.

  • The graduation rate at UAM is higher than Miles College (23% vs. 20%)
  • Graduates from University of Arkansas at Monticello earn on average $5,800 more per year than Miles College graduates after ten years. ($33,800 vs. $28,000)
  • University of Arkansas at Monticello students graduate with a $21,172 lower median federal student loan debt than Miles College graduates. ($15,000 vs. $36,172)
  • UAM graduates are paying $219 less per month on federal student loans than Miles College graduates. ($155 vs. $374)
  • More UAM gra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Miles College students, three years after graduation. (38% vs. 15%)
